In the last 75km, the most notorious passages are lurking: from the Koppenberg and the Hotond to the Oude Kwaremont and the Paterberg. Riders and fans are eagerly looking forward to the finish in the centre of Oudenaarde. The champions sprint to the finish line. In Oudenaarde you experience it from the front row: live and on the big screen. The Donkmeer and the Markt are the place to be. You can see the race live 4 times. If you walk up and down between the market square of Oudenaarde and the arrival area you will see the race pass by and be able to witness two finishes (men and women).

Shuttle bus to Oude Kwaremont

There is a free shuttle bus from Oudenaarde station up to the public village on the Oude Kwaremont where you can see the riders 3 times. There are pubs, food and beer vans and a big screen so you can alternate between standing by the road-side and watching the big screen.

Tour of Flanders review

One of the highlights of the Sportive calendar, We Ride Flanders (the Tour of Flanders Sportive) takes place at the end of March. The day before the Tour of Flanders, amateur cyclists from around the world descend on Flanders and ride the Tour of Flanders on the same roads as the pros will the day after. The event is massive. About 16,000 cyclists from all over the world take on the Flemish ‘bergs’, and cobblestones.

Choice of distance

To make this event accessible to all levels of riders, participants can choose from 4 distances. The longest is a whopping 229km and starts in Antwerp. Riders can start from 7am (time to be confirmed). 

The 3 other distances (158, 128 and 80 km) all start and finish in Oudenaarde. Starting times are staggered in such a way that riders are spread out as much as possible along the course. The routes of these 3 distances have remained the same as in previous years so everyone gets to ride the Koppenberg, Oude Kwaremont and the Paterberg.

An added measure to ensure riding pleasure for all is that security has been stepped up. Frame plates will be checked to prevent people taking part who are not officially registered. Also, at the foot of the Koppenberg, a large video screen displays the current situation on the climb. Those who find it too busy or prefer to avoid the difficult cobblestone climb can follow a small detour. In this way, each participant can complete his or her Tour of Flanders in the most comfortable and safe manner possible.

The Finish in Oudenaarde

The finish area in Oudenaarde has undergone a major facelift and has been transformed into a real We Ride Flanders café. Participants and supporters can go to one of the various food and drink stands in a fully decorated cycling café and immerse themselves in the atmosphere and history of the Ronde. For example, you can go there for a mini exhibition of the Tour of Flanders Centre, admire bicycles and jerseys of former winners, and relive the previous editions of the Tour of Flanders on one of the big screens. It is the place to linger, recover and chat after the cycling experience.

Facts and figures of We Ride Flanders

16,000 participants split as follows over the various distances:

  • 75km: 200 participants
  • 144km: 5000 participants
  • 177km: 4500 participants
  • 242km: 4000 participants

5,920 Belgians, 10,000 participants from abroad, 64 nationalities.

Top 5 countries:

  • Belgium: 5,920 participants
  • Netherlands: 2,900 participants
  • Great Britain: 2,000 participants
  • France: 1,755 participants
  • Italy: 810 participants
